World of Lighthouses

New photos of lighthouses every day

Instagram
Delaware River - Pea Patch Island - Dike E - N End light - all pictures
J1308-6.jpg
Delaware River - Pea Patch Island - Dike E - N End lightJ1308.676 viewscaptainpet
     
1 files on 1 page(s)